Hi there,

I have problems with many off the rack suits due to my broad shoulders, so suit jackets with little to no shoulder pads fit the best for me. Any recommendations? I wear a 38S in most brands. Any recommendations will be greatly appreciated!

I have the same issue. I hate shoulder padding and roping. I'd consider Caruso and Eidos at that price range. I personally have 3 Eidos Tenero suits and they fit me great OTR. I would also try Thick as Thieves. They're a vendor on here and they make custom suits. They're great to deal with and prices are more than reasonable. Best of luck mate
